The Afterlife of a Gun

Mike McIntire, an investigative reporter for The New York Times, dives deep into the complex realities of gun disposal and repurposing in America. He shares insights on how well-intentioned gun buyback programs can lead to unintended consequences. While innovative disposal methods like firearms pulverization are introduced, ethical dilemmas arise as salvaged parts enter the secondary market. McIntire discusses the feelings of betrayal among those who hoped for permanent elimination of their surrendered guns, revealing the challenges of achieving true community safety.

The Mysterious Gun Study That’s Advancing Gun Rights

Mike McIntire, an investigative reporter at The New York Times, dives into a controversial study that's reshaping the legal landscape of gun rights in America. He reveals how this research, linked to pro-gun interests, is leveraged by activists to challenge gun regulations. The discussion highlights recent legal victories, scrutinizes the study's methodology, and explores the mysterious figure behind it, Dr. William English. McIntire also touches on broader implications for future gun rights research and its visibility in ongoing legal battles.

The Secret History of Gun Rights

In this insightful discussion, Mike McIntire, an investigative reporter for The New York Times, reveals the hidden history of the NRA. He explains how the NRA transformed from a small group of sports enthusiasts into a powerful lobbying force. Key topics include the intricate relationship between Congress and the NRA, particularly the political maneuvers following events like the Columbine shooting. McIntire also delves into evolving gun culture, the influence of legislators on gun rights, and the ongoing dialogue needed to address these contentious issues.
